WebAug 18, 2024 · Below are a few examples of daily and monthly APR calculations: Daily APR calculation. You can calculate daily APR in four steps. Find the daily periodic rate by dividing the APR by 365 (the number of days in a year). Example: If your credit card has 20% APR, the daily periodic rate is 0.05% Formula: 0.20 ÷ 365 = 0.000547 WebJan 7, 2024 · The calculation would look as follows: [ ($200 x 6 days) + ($300 x 13 days) + ($250 x 6 days)] / 25 = $264. Then, in order to find your interest charges for the period using the average daily balance method, you plug the $264 figure into the formula: (APR x No. of Days in the Billing Cycle x Average Daily Balance) / 365.

WebOct 17, 2024 · 1. Convert the Annual Rate to the Daily Rate. The daily rate is determined by dividing your credit card’s APR by 365 to find the rate per day.
